TPS79930DDCTG4 by Texas Instruments

TPS79930DDCTG4 by Texas Instruments is a fixed positive single output LDO regulator with a nominal output voltage of 3V and max output current of 0.2A. Operating temperature ranges from -40 to 125°C, making it suitable for various applications in electronics requiring stable voltage regulation. The compact package style and surface mount capability enhance its versatility in space-constrained designs.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

This material provides durability and protection for the regulator, making it suitable for various applications.

Maximum Dropout Voltage-1: 1.175 V

Low dropout voltage ensures efficient power regulation even with small input-to-output differentials.

Surface Mount: YES

Ease of installation and compatibility with modern PCB assembly processes.

Operating Temperature (TJ-Max): 125°C

Wide operating temperature range allows for reliable performance in varying environmental conditions.

Technology: BICMOS

Utilizes a combination of bipolar and CMOS technologies for high efficiency and low power consumption.

Minimum Output Voltage-1: 2.94 V

Provides stable output voltage above the minimum required levels for many applications.

Nominal Output Voltage-1: 3 V

Stable and precise output voltage for consistent performance of connected devices.

Package Style (Meter): SMALL OUTLINE, THIN PROFILE, SHRINK PITCH

Compact and space-saving design for efficient PCB layout and system integration.

Adjustability: FIXED

Set output voltage eliminates the need for external adjustments, simplifying design and operation.

Maximum Output Current-1: 0.2 A

Able to supply moderate current levels for powering various components in a circuit.

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
